May 15--Go ahead. Try to make sense of the Phillies' play so far this season.
A team many thought would contend for a playoff spot has spent exactly zero days above .500. The offense has proved potent some days, anemic others. Consistency has been nonexistent.
Still, the Phillies have yet to reach the quarter pole of the season. To write their obituary now would be to risk ridicule later.
Instead, let's look for the next time to take the Phillies' temperature. Memorial Day seems like a reasonable moment for assessment.
